Overview

The 81202HC634 heating/cooling controller is a high-performance PID controller designed for precise thermal process management. With universal input compatibility, advanced control modes, and flexible output options, it is ideal for applications requiring accurate heating and cooling control with programmable profiles.

Key Features
• Universal input support (thermocouples, Pt100, current, voltage, mV)
• Advanced control modes (PID, PI, PD, P, On/Off)
• Dedicated heating and cooling control functionality
• Multiple control outputs (SSR pulse, analog, relay)
• Ramp and soak programming capability
• Integrated digital input/output
• RS485 communication with Modbus protocol
• USB Mini-B configuration interface
• Password-protected configuration
• Compact 48 × 48 mm (DIN 1/16) panel-mount design

Applications
Industrial heating and cooling systems, ovens, furnaces, HVAC systems, plastics processing, and process automation

Specifications

  • Input Types:
    Thermocouples: J, K, T, N, R, S, B, E
    RTD: Pt100
    Linear signals: 0–20 mA, 4–20 mA, 0–50 mV, 0–5 VDC, 0–10 VDC

Measurement Features

  • Accuracy:
    Thermocouples J, K, T: 0.25% of span ±1°C
    Thermocouples N, R, S, B: 0.25% of span ±3°C
    Pt100 and linear signals: 0.2% of span
  • Input Resolution: 32767 levels (15 bits)
  • Sampling Rate: Up to 55 samples per second

Control Features

  • Control Types: PID, PI, PD, P, On/Off
  • Control Action: Heating or Cooling
  • Ramp & Soak Programs:
    20 programs with up to 9 segments each

Outputs

  • Control Outputs:
    SSR pulse
    4–20 mA analog control
    Relay output
  • Relay Outputs:
    2 relays (standard)
    Optional additional relay
  • Digital I/O:
    Integrated digital input/output
  • Analog Output:
    0–20 mA or 4–20 mA
    Resolution: 31,000 levels

Alarm Functions

  • Minimum, Maximum
  • Differential, Low, Differential High
  • Open sensor detection
  • Ramp and soak event alarms

Detection & Diagnostics

  • Open sensor (loop break) detection
  • Heater break detection (optional)

Communication

  • Interface: RS485
  • Protocol: Modbus

Configuration & Safety

  • Interface: USB Mini-B (powered)
  • Protection: Password-protected parameters

Electrical Specifications

  • Power Supply:
    12–24 VDC
    Optional: 100–240 VAC
  • Maximum Consumption: 9 VA

Mechanical Specifications

  • Dimensions: 48 × 48 × 110 mm (DIN 1/16)

Protection & Enclosure

  • Front Panel: IP65, Polycarbonate (PC) UL94 V-2
  • Enclosure: IP20, ABS + PC UL94 V-0

Environmental Conditions

  • Operating Temperature: 5 to 50°C (41 to 122°F)
  • Humidity: 0 to 80% RH

Compliance & Approvals

  • CE, RoHS, REACH, UL, cUL
